大一java实训报告今天完成了项目myproject中的那些功能?

如题所述

额,项目myproject指我的项目,请详细描述问题
既然如此假设建立一个图书管理程序,包含以下功能:
1. 用户登录和注册功能:实现了用户的注册和登录功能,包括输入用户名和密码进行登录验证,并提供注册新用户的选项。
2. 数据库连接:建立了与数据库的连接,并实现了用户信息的存储和读取功能。
3. 图书管理功能:实现了书籍的添加、删除、查询和修改功能,包括书名、作者、出版社等书籍信息的录入和更新。
4. 借阅功能:实现了用户借阅和归还书籍的功能,包括查询可借阅书籍、借阅书籍和归还书籍等操作。
5. 用户权限管理功能:实现了管理员权限和普通用户权限的划分,管理员可以对图书进行管理和用户权限的控制,普通用户只能进行借阅和归还操作。
6. 图书信息统计功能:实现了根据不同的条件对图书信息进行统计和分析,包括按照作者、出版社、借阅情况等进行统计。
7. 用户信息管理功能:实现了管理员对用户信息进行管理的功能,包括用户信息的查询、删除和修改等操作。
8. 图书推荐功能:根据用户的借阅记录和偏好,利用算法实现了对用户的图书推荐功能,提供个性化的推荐给用户。
温馨提示:答案为网友推荐,仅供参考
相似回答